Responsibilities



Manage the day-to-day operations of the CACFP, including monitoring meal reimbursements, recordkeeping, and compliance documentation. Provide comprehensive training and technical assistance to program participants, ensuring they understand federal regulations, application procedures, and reporting requirements. Conduct regular site visits to verify adherence to program standards, review meal service practices, and support continuous improvement efforts. Collaborate with childcare providers, adult care facilities, and community organizations to facilitate enrollment processes and resolve any operational challenges. Maintain accurate records of participant data, meal counts, financial transactions, and compliance reports in accordance with federal guidelines. Stay current on updates to CACFP policies and regulations by engaging in ongoing professional development and training sessions. Prepare detailed reports on program performance, compliance status, and areas for enhancement to inform management decisions. Advocate for best practices in nutrition standards and promote educational initiatives that encourage healthy eating habits among program participants.
